The L92 in the Denali and Escalade doesn't have AFM. The Pontiac G8 has AFM but no VVT. Some of the 6.0L trucks now have both AFM and VVT. The L99 is the first full production 6.2L with both. The first few 6.2L 2007 Escalades came with it but it was disabled.
